图片瘦身解决方案是指通过一系列优化技术和算法,减小图片文件的大小,提升图片加载速度,从而优化网页加载速度和用户体验。
图片瘦身解决方案的分类主要有以下几种:
- 图片压缩:通过无损或有损压缩算法,减小图片文件的体积,降低网络传输成本。常见的图片压缩算法有JPEG、PNG等。
- 图片格式转换:将图片转换为适合网络传输和浏览器渲染的格式,如将BMP格式转换为JPEG或PNG格式。
- 图片缩放:根据不同终端设备的分辨率和屏幕大小,调整图片尺寸,减少不必要的像素。这样可以减小图片文件的大小,同时避免在页面加载时进行不必要的缩放操作。
- 图片延迟加载:对于页面中的大量图片,可以先加载页面的核心内容,再异步加载剩余的图片资源。这样可以提升页面的初次加载速度,减少用户等待时间。
- 雪碧图(Sprite)技术:将多张小图片合并成一张大图,在页面加载时只需要请求一张大图,减少HTTP请求次数,提升页面加载速度。
图片瘦身解决方案的优势包括:
- 加速页面加载速度:优化后的图片文件体积更小,可以更快地从服务器传输到客户端,加快网页加载速度,提升用户体验。
- 节省网络带宽:优化后的图片文件占用更少的网络带宽,可以减少网络传输成本,降低服务器负载。
- 节省存储空间:优化后的图片文件更小,占用更少的存储空间,减少服务器存储成本。
- 提升搜索引擎排名:页面加载速度是搜索引擎优化(SEO)的重要因素之一,通过优化图片加载速度,可以提升网页在搜索引擎中的排名。
图片瘦身解决方案在以下场景中得到广泛应用:
- 网页开发:在网页中使用优化后的图片文件,可以提升页面加载速度,改善用户体验。
- 移动应用开发:移动设备的网络带宽和存储空间有限,通过图片瘦身可以减少应用的网络传输成本和存储空间占用。
- 社交媒体应用:社交媒体平台上大量的用户上传图片,通过图片瘦身可以提升图片上传和浏览的速度。
- 电子商务应用:电子商务网站上的商品图片数量庞大,通过图片瘦身可以提升商品浏览和购买的体验。
腾讯云提供了一系列与图片瘦身解决方案相关的产品和服务:
- 图片处理(Image Processing):提供图片压缩、图片格式转换、图片缩放、图片裁剪等功能,帮助用户实现图片瘦身。产品介绍链接:https://cloud.tencent.com/product/imgpro
通过腾讯云的图片处理产品,用户可以轻松实现对图片的压缩、格式转换、缩放、裁剪等操作,实现图片瘦身,提升网页加载速度和用户体验。